Efficacy, safety and immunogenicity of the biosimilar etanercept compared to the reference formulation original etanercept in patients with rheumatoid arthritis: An open-label, randomized, comparative, multicenter study.
The objective of this phase III clinical randomized trial was to establish the therapeutic equivalence of biosimilar etanercept (bio-etanercept) with original etanercept (O-etanercept) for patients diagnosed with rheumatoid arthritis. ⋯ This study showed that bio-etanercept was equivalent to the reference formulation.

Patients' compliance and receptivity to nonimmersive virtual reality (NIVR) can enhance their long-term exercise therapy compliance for neurological illnesses. Patients with Parkinson disease (PD) have age-standardized rates of disability, death, and prevalence that are rising the fastest; several researches have revealed that there is no known cure for PD at this time. Thus, the current study investigates how NIVR affects patients with PD using Wii-Fit exercises. Therefore, the present study investigates the effects of NIVR using Wii-Fit exercises among patients with PD. ⋯ The review suggests that NIVR is effective for balance rehabilitation but ineffective for cognitive improvement in patients with PD aged >18 to 85 years.

Orbital fat is an adipose tissue located behind orbital septum and originates from mesoderm and neural crest in ectoderm. It has been found that the histologic structure of orbital fat is different from subcutaneous and visceral fat. In addition, the regeneration and anti-inflammatory ability of stem cells derived from orbital fat have attracted much attention in recent years. This paper reviews the recent research progress on orbital fat, including its structure, origin, histological characteristics, and related stem cells.

Desmoid tumors of rectus abdominis: A case report and literature review.
Desmoid tumor (DT) is a rare soft tissue tumor that can occur anywhere in the body. Abdominal wall DT presents unique clinical challenges due to its distinctive manifestations, treatment modalities, and the lack of biomarkers for diagnosis and recurrence prediction, making clinical decisions exceedingly complex. ⋯ Abdominal wall DT treatment requires personalized plans from multidisciplinary team discussions. Genetic testing plays a crucial role in identifying novel biomarkers for abdominal wall DT. We have once again demonstrated the significant clinical significance of CTNNB1 mutations in the diagnosis and progression of abdominal wall DT. Additionally, genes such as CCND1, CYP3A4, SLIT1, RRM1, STIM1, ESR2, UGT1A1, among others, may also be closely associated with the progression of abdominal wall DT. Future research should delve deeper into and systematically evaluate the precise impact of these genetic mutations on treatment selection and prognosis for abdominal wall DT, in order to better guide patient management and treatment decisions.
